Holiday Cottages in Coleford

The market town of Coleford is a great place to stay if you’re planning a short break near the Forest of Dean or the Wye Valley. Once the birthplace of the modern steel industry, remnants of the mines, furnaces and ironworks still exist — although many have since been absorbed back into the forest landscape. Best things to do in Coleford

If you’re looking for forest-filled family fun, this is the place. There are so many outdoor adventures to be had in this beautiful corner of Gloucestershire. Here are some ideas:

  • Symonds Yat: This is a popular spot for walkers who enjoy picturesque views of the River Wye. There are waymarked trails and cycle routes, plus it's a great place to enjoy bird watching, too.
  • Hopewell Colliery: Strap on your helmet and take a guided underground tour of this working mine. Walk through miles of subterranean tunnels and exit through beautiful woodland before heading back to the museum and cafe.
  • Clearwell Caves: Underneath the forest floor lies a network of natural caves, caverns and winding passageways which are open to the public. Time your trip right and you may be able to experience underground musical performances and theatre shows!
  • Puzzlewood: Explore the delights of this ancient woodland with a magical atmosphere created by twisted trees, paths, bridges and lookout points. It’s the perfect day out for all the family.
  • Perrygrove Adventure Railway: Toot toot! Take a family (and dog) friendly train ride through woods and meadows. There’s also a Twilight Village and a Treetop Adventure Trail which kids of all ages will love.

How to get to Coleford

If you’re travelling from one of the major cities in the UK, below shows an average distance to Coleford, so you know what to expect when choosing to visit by car.

London: 137 miles

Birmingham: 81 miles

Glasgow: 355 miles

Liverpool: 136 miles

Bristol: 31 miles

Manchester: 152 miles

Leeds: 193 miles

Edinburgh: 358 miles

Newcastle: 279 miles
